NZ sevens team named for Glasgow

1:15 pm on 9 July 2014

The New Zealand sevens coach Gordon Tietjens has shown faith in most of his World Series regulars in naming the team he hopes will win a fifth consecutive Commonwealth Games gold.

The 12-strong team to travel to Glasgow includes three players who won gold in Delhi four years ago - captain DJ Forbes, Sherwin Stowers and Tim Mikkelson.

The squad also features the return of two former members in last year's World Cup winner Pita Ahki and Declan O'Donnell.

Missing the cut are the veterans Lote Raikabula and Tomasi Cama.

Two additional players will be named as reserves at the end of this week's training in Mt Maunganui and will travel with the team to the Netherlands for a pre-Games training camp on July the 14th.

They will return home if not required.

New Zealand play Canada, Scotland and Barbados in pool play at the Glasgow games, with all three games taking place on Saturday, July the 26th (NZ time).

The team is:

Pita Ahki (North Harbour)

Scott Curry (Manawatu)

Sam Dickson (Canterbury)

DJ Forbes (captain) (Counties Manukau)

Bryce Heem (Tasman)

Akira Ioane (Auckland)

Gillies Kaka (Hawke's Bay)

Ben Lam (Auckland)

Tim Mikkelson (Waikato)

Declan O'Donnell (Waikato)

Sherwin Stowers (Counties Manukau)

Joe Webber (Waikato)
